Escape window installation services involve the placement of specialized windows designed to serve as emergency exits in residential and commercial properties. These windows are typically installed in basements, bedrooms, or other habitable spaces where a secondary escape route may be necessary. The process includes selecting the appropriate window type, ensuring proper sizing, and securely fitting the window to meet safety standards. Proper installation is essential to guarantee that the window functions correctly during emergencies and complies with local building codes.

This service addresses common safety concerns related to limited escape options during emergencies such as fires or natural disasters. An escape window provides a quick and accessible exit route, potentially reducing the risk of injury or entrapment. It also enhances overall safety by ensuring that residents and occupants can evacuate promptly if needed. Additionally, escape window installation can improve property value and meet safety regulations for certain types of properties or occupancy requirements.

The overview below groups typical Escape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Chatham County, NC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Material Costs - The cost for materials used in escape window installation typically ranges from $300 to $1,200 per window, depending on the type and size of the window selected. For example, basic egress windows may cost around $400, while larger or custom options can reach $1,000 or more.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ing escape windows usually fall between $500 and $1,500 per window. Factors influencing this range include the complexity of the installation and local labor rates in Chatham County, NC.

Additional Fees - Additional costs may include permits, which can range from $50 to $200, and any necessary structural modifications. These fees vary based on local regulations and the specific requirements of the installation site.

Total Project Cost - Overall, the total expense for escape window installation services can vary from approximately $800 to $3,000 per window. The final price depends on material choices, installation complexity, and regional service provider rates.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in installing an escape window? Installation typically includes preparing the opening, ensuring proper framing, and securely fitting the window to meet safety standards. It is recommended to work with experienced local contractors for proper installation.

How long does an escape window installation usually take? The duration depends on the complexity of the project and the property. Consulting with local service providers can provide a more accurate estimate based on specific needs.

Are there building codes or regulations for escape window installations? Yes, local building codes often specify size, height, and egress requirements for escape windows. Contractors familiar with local regulations can ensure compliance.

What types of windows are suitable for escape purposes? Common options include casement, awning, or sliding windows designed to open easily and provide an emergency exit. Local pros can recommend suitable styles for your property.

Can existing windows be converted into escape windows? In some cases, existing windows can be modified to meet escape requirements. Consulting with local installation experts can determine if conversion is feasible.
